Step 7: Hardening the Mailharrow bounce processor. The legacy handler parsed bounce payloads with elevated filesystem access; the replacement runs in a restricted sandbox and classifies hard versus soft bounces before touching the suppression list. Verify that the old service account has been revoked and that audit logging is enabled prior to enabling traffic. The sandboxed processor starts with the configuration below.

service settings:
[casax]
port = 6379
team = rusir
host = casax.zemvarhq.corp
region = outer-4
access_code = ac_9808ce
timeout_ms = 1500

**Quiet Room — Level 11, Bramford House**

The quiet room on the top floor is for focused work, rest, or prayer. No calls, no meetings, no food. Maximum stay is two hours. Lights are sensor-controlled; leave the blinds as you find them. The door stays locked at all times, so use the entry code below.

badge for fafop-fajof: bdg-Z-47

## Pinpointer Widget — Environments

The Pinpointer address autocomplete widget runs in three environments: sandbox, preview, and prod. Sandbox uses a synthetic address corpus and has no rate limiting. Preview mirrors prod data weekly and is where integration partners test. Prod serves live traffic behind the Dunmere edge cache.

On-call: latency alerts almost always trace back to the suggestion index rebuild, which runs hourly in prod only.

Prod runs with the following configuration values.

service settings:
[silwyn]
host = silwyn.crelvogrid.internal
user = silwyn_svc
database = silwyn_prod